If we study the vibration of a pipe open at both ends, then which of the following statements is not true?
Options
(a) Odd harmonies of the fundamental frequency will be generated
(b) All harmonies of the fundamental frequency will be generated
(c) Pressure change will be maximum at both ends
(d) Antinode will be at open end
Correct Answer:
Pressure change will be maximum at both ends
Explanation:
Pressure change will be minimum at both ends. In fact, pressure variation is maximum at l/2 because the displacement node is pressure antinode.
